Augusta: Fire in Crimora a $700K loss

Contributors

Staff Report

A fire destroyed an auto shop in Crimora that was not insured, according to its owner.

American Way Auto Collision Repair Center owner William Burrow told The News Leader that he estimates the loss just in vehicles at $300,000.

The News Virginian reported the overall damage estimate at $700,000.

Among the items lost were several restored vintage vehicles

No injuries were reported in the Tuesday blaze. Firefighters from Dooms, New Hope, Verona, Grottoes, Fishersville and Augusta County responded to the scene.
